
IfcConnectionConstraint
Definition from IAI: The connection constraint is an addional constraint
that acts on an element connection. It can be used to describe either an
expansion joint, edge condition, control joint.
HISTORY New Entity in IFC
Release 2.0, entity has been renamed from IfcRelJoinsElements in IFC Release
2x.
ISSUES See issue and change logs for changes made in IFC Release
2x
